Just do it! “Couleurs d’Erasmus” inspires students to study abroad

The vernissage „Couleurs d’Erasmus – Photo Reports by Erasmus Students“ impressively demonstrated on 30 June 2026 how enriching international mobility, foreign language learning and Franco-German exchange can be. Around 40 guests attended the presentation by Isoline Rossi as well as the subsequent panel discussion with Dr. Maria Worf (Managing Director of the Center for Foreign Languages at Chemnitz University of Technology), Dr. Andreas Rauch (Coordinator for French at the Center for Foreign Languages) and Dr. Wolfgang Lambrecht (Deputy Director of the University Library) on the opportunities and perspectives of European mobility as well as on study and life experiences in France.

The lively discussion made clear what kinds of experiences a stay abroad can offer: new perspectives, greater language confidence, personal development and encounters that reach far beyond one’s studies. One central message of the evening was formulated very clearly by students, the panel and the audience alike: anyone who has the opportunity to go abroad should give it a try. Or, in short: just do it!
The evening highlighted the contribution that foreign languages and international mobility make to personal and academic development. At the same time, the exhibition showed how diverse Erasmus experiences can be and how strongly they encourage students to take the step into another country, another language and another university culture.

The exhibition can still be seen in the foyer of the University Library until 20 July 2026.

Couleurs d’Erasmus: Photo Reports by Erasmus Students

At the opening of the exhibition on Tuesday, 30 June 2026, at 7:00 p.m. in the IdeenReich of Chemnitz University Library, Isoline Rossi (Campus France Germany), Dr Maria Worf (Managing Director of the Foreign Language Centre), Dr Andreas Rauch (Coordinator for French) and Dr Wolfgang Lambrecht (Acting Director of Chemnitz University Library) will discuss the opportunities and perspectives of European mobility as well as study and life experiences in France. The exhibition was developed by Campus France Germany in cooperation with the Institut français Germany on the occasion of the Erasmus Days.

Start and Registration Period for Language Courses in Summer Semester 2026

The language courses in the summer semester will begin on 13 April 26. Registration for the language courses is possible via OPAL from 30 March to 08 April 26.
